Atlético Bucaramanga will receive Atlético Mineiro on Thursday, July 17 for the first leg of the 2025 South American Cup playoffs, a round that faces the third parties of the Copa Libertadores with the seconds of the South American.

The Colombian team comes precisely from the Libertadores and will seek to take advantage of its location to face the series.

On the other side will be Atlético Mineiro, one of Brazil's four representatives in these playoffs, along with Bahía, Vasco da Gama and Guild.

For Colombia, in addition to Bucaramanga, América de Cali (which already tied 0-0 with Bahia) and Once Caldas (who plays Wednesday against San Antonio Bulo) participates.

The game is emerging as a complex duel for Bucaramanga, which will play against one of the greats of Brazil.

The Team that advances will be added to those already classified to the eighths, an instance to which the group winners directly accessed.
